Tucson City Council voted to ban standing or walking in city medians for any reason other than legal crossing Tuesday night.
A violation could land someone an up to $250 fine and/or up to 24 hours in jail. However, in city communications, City Manager Tim Thomure said that “not every violation of these ordinances will result in an enforcement action or citation” due to a lack of city resources.
The traffic median ordinance was one of three that Tucson’s Mayor and Council considered at their meeting. All three related to Tucson’s unhoused or housing insecure populations…
